India, Aug. 6 -- UEFA is preparing to commission an independent valuation of FIFA's abandoned World Cup investment proposal as it intensifies its challenge to Gianni Infantino's leadership and examines whether the governing body was prepared to sell its future commercial profits below their true market value.

The European governing body remains dissatisfied despite Infantino issuing a written apology to FIFA's 211 member associations following crisis talks in Morocco. UEFA is expected to continue pushing for his removal while subjecting the failed FIFA Forward Enterprise project to greater financial and governance scrutiny.
